Introduction of Foundation
A foundation is the element of an architectural
structure which connects it to the ground, and
transfers loads from the structure to the ground.
Foundations are generally considered either
shallow or deep.
Foundation engineering is the application of soil
mechanics and rock mechanics in the design of
foundation elements of structures

Shallow Foundation
Shallow foundation are those foundation which is near to the finished
ground surface generally where the depth of the foundation is less than
width and also less than 3m
1. Isolated footing:- Individual footing or Isolated footing is most
common type of foundation used for building construction This
foundation is constructed for single column and also called as pad
foundation.
2. Combined footing:-It is the combination of the isolated footing
which is constructed for the separate columns the shape of this
footing is rectangle and used when loads from structure is carried by
columns.

2. Strip footing:-
Spread footing are those whose base is more wider than a typical load
bearing wall foundations the wider base of these footing type spread the
weight from the building structure over more area and provides better
stability.
4. Raft foundation:-
Raft and mat foundation are the types of foundation which are spread
across the entire area of the building to support heavy structural loads
from columns and walls the use of mat foundatipn is for coloumns and
walls foundations where the loads from he structure on coloumns and
walls are very high.

Deep foundation
Deep foundation are those foundations which to deeply below the
finished ground surface for their base bearing capacity to be affected
by surface conditions these is usually at depth greater than 3M. below
the finished ground level.
Types of deep foundation
1.Pile foundation:-Pile foundation resist loads from structure by
skin friction and end bearing use of pile foundations also prevents
differential settlement of foundation by using the mechanical
machineries at the depth of the hard strata the piles given.It is circular
in shape.
2.Caisson foundation:- Caisson foundation is also called as
drilled shafts and has actions similar to pile foundation but are high
capacity cast in situ foundation it resist the load from structure through
shaft resistance.
